GP53 HGD is a 2004 Renault Clio in Red with a 1,149c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 71.4%.
Across all 2004 Renault Clio models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.7% with a typical mileage of 61,492 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Renault Clio f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 660,730 recorded failures. If you're considering buying GP53 HGD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Renault Clio typ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 22 years old, this Renault Clio is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
